<p>Oxygen homeostasis is a key ecological factor shaping microbial composition, epithelial function, and immune balance in the gut. Spatial and developmental oxygen gradients drive the transition from facultative to obligate anaerobes. Gut hypoxia is maintained by epithelial oxygen consumption and microbial metabolism, forming a positive feedback loop that supports barrier integrity and immune homeostasis. Disruption by inflammation, antibiotics, or diet elevates oxygen availability, promoting dysbiosis, pathogen expansion, and disease risk.</p>
